Ok here is the problem that is driving me nuts.

I am running XP with all updates and service packs. I had a problem at one
stage and repaired it by repair install.
Since then something is shutting down my internet connection (broadband
always on) at random. It seems to be something like a firewall preventing
connection to my modem. I have changed the modem and the cabling just to be
sure it is not them and this was all to no avail.

I had Zone Alarms installed and took it off. I have disabled the Windows
Firewall. I am still running the Norton anti virus softwear that has worm
protection enabled

All and any help would be very welcome.

It sounds like a virus or spyware. Do an online scan at Trend Micro and run
a couple spyware scans. I'd also uninstall Norton and use AVG.
